About Rita Noumeir
Rita Noumeir is a scholar working on Health Information Management, Radiology, Nuclear Medicine and Imaging and Computer Vision and Pattern Recognition, having authored 81 papers that have together received 848 indexed citations. Recurring topics across this work include Medical Imaging Techniques and Applications (11 papers), Non-Invasive Vital Sign Monitoring (10 papers) and Electronic Health Records Systems (7 papers). The work is most often cited by research in Health Informatics (27 citations), Computer Vision and Pattern Recognition (313 citations) and Health Information Management (49 citations). Rita Noumeir has collaborated with scholars based in Canada, France and United States. Frequent co-authors include Philippe Jouvet, Wassim Bouachir, Sandrine Essouri, Jean‐Marc Lina, G.E. Mailloux, Georges Kaddoum, Michaël Sauthier, Jung Ho Kim, Ho Min Kim and Ji Hyung Kim.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and IEEE Transactions on Geoscience and Remote Sensing.
